What about renaming people/rooms locally only? (e.g. changes visible only to me.)

e.g. suppose my friend Jon names himself, "His Excellency Lord Jon of Burns, the Wise and Stately Patriarch," I may not have a problem with him choosing to present himself to others using such pretentious honorifics, but it might be nice to shorten his name to "Jon" locally only for my own consumption.

Also generally I've found less technical people don't bother with setting display names, so it would be nice to be able to set them locally so I don't have to memorize their usernames.
